Aracılığıyla paylaş


PipelineBuffer.GetString Yöntemi

Alır dize arabellekte saklanan sütun.

Ad Alanı:  Microsoft.SqlServer.Dts.Pipeline
Derleme:  Microsoft.SqlServer.PipelineHost (Microsoft.SqlServer.PipelineHost içinde.dll)

Sözdizimi

'Bildirim
Public Function GetString ( _
    columnIndex As Integer _
) As String
'Kullanım
Dim instance As PipelineBuffer
Dim columnIndex As Integer
Dim returnValue As String

returnValue = instance.GetString(columnIndex)
public string GetString(
    int columnIndex
)
public:
String^ GetString(
    int columnIndex
)
member GetString : 
        columnIndex:int -> string 
public function GetString(
    columnIndex : int
) : String

Parametreler

  • columnIndex
    Tür: System.Int32
    Dizini sütun arabellek satırda.

Dönüş Değeri

Tür: System.String
Arabellekte saklanan dize sütun.

Açıklamalar

Bu yöntem ile aşağıdaki çalışır Integration Services veri türleri:

Arabellek sütun atanmış değer bir dize veya arabellek sütun ise DataType değil bir DT_STR, DT_WSTR, DT_TEXT, veya DT_NTEXT, bir UnsupportedBufferDataTypeException oluşur.

Varsa değeri sütun NULL, PipelineBuffer üreten bir ColumnIsNullException.Null için arama yoluyla kontrol edebilirsiniz IsNull yöntem.

Eksiksiz bir listesini görmek için Integration Services veri türleri ve karşılık gelen Al ve Set yöntemleri PipelineBuffer sınıfına her türü ile kullanmak için bkz: Veri akışı veri türleriyle çalışma.